Chief (Mrs) Monisade Afuye, Ekiti Deputy Governor has announced the passing away of her mother, Olori Esther Iyalaje Adegboye.

A press statement was released by the Deputy Governor that Olori Adegboye died at the early hours of Tuesday after a protracted illness. She was 97 years old.
Olori Adegboye, a native of Ikere Ekiti, in Ekiti State, as revealed by her daughter, the Ekiti State Deputy Governor, said her late mother was a caring and resourceful community leader who played a significant role in community development and fostering unity in Ikere Ekiti, and her contributions will be fondly remembered by the community and the Akayejo Royal Dynasty.
Olori Adegboye is survived by extended family members, children, grandchildren, and great-grandchildren.
Burial arrangements will be announced later. The Deputy Governor has prayed that God should grant her mother eternal rest and sustain the family she left behind.
